Colonial banks corporate netball title

Saturday, November 21, 2009

COLONIAL reigned supreme as it beat Fiji Sports Council 22-14 to retain its NewWorld Suva Netball Business House competition on Thursday night.

The likes of Robert Wojick, Samisoni Vugakoto, Bill Savu and Hannah Tuikoro laid the platform for Colonial as it battered its way past the FSC side.

Led by Della Shaw, FSC put up a spirited show but was not fortunate to break the Colonial resilience.

Colonial opened up its lead in the third quarter, which was a power play quarter.

This meant a goal scored within the shooting circle was worth two points and those shot from outside four points.

Competition co-ordinator Fata-fehi Daunivuka said teamwork and skills laid the foundation for Colonial.

"Hannah Tuikoro used her basketball and netball skills to set up national basketball representative, Sakiusa Rokodi for netball goals with ease using his basketball skills to perfection," Daunivuka said.

He said the introduction of power play and certain aspects of fastnet determined winners with two and four points up for goal scored.

"Third quarter determined Colonial's championship status as it won 8-6 and powerplay was evident in determining the winners, he said. The Suva Netball Association received a big boost as NewWorld confirmed it would sponsor again 2010 corporate league.
